Not having a car I am reliant on public transport. I go to an area and then blitz it over a number of days, doing as many hills as I can. I camp out in the hills for up to ten days at a time, self-sufficient, so most of my hills are done with a large pack on my back. I like to camp overnight on the summits: a good way of avoiding the worst of the midges. I'm still doing the Ms, Cs and Gs, but I do the lower hills when I can, and have now done the majority of local Marilyns. I moved to Scotland in 1999 and since then have been ticking off about 60 Marilyns a year.
